My Jacarini finches had a nest in a lilly pilly tree with 2 babies & they were doin well almost a week. But found 1 dead 1 day & the other the nexted up the far end of the aviary.They have a Australia Native Planted Aviary its 3x3x3. Mixed species of finches,canary,quail. They have seed,insect mix,cununga grit, grass seeds. Wat went wrong.

I've never kept them but from what I remember I'm pretty sure they require live food (eg meal-worms, termites or maggots) in order to raise their young.
